Comfort For Daily Use

I own the Ather Rizta mainly for family rides and get about 123 km range depending on variant. The top speed feels around 80 km/h and ground clearance is good for uneven surfaces. The kerb weight feels manageable and the tubeless 12-inch tyres provide a smooth, sure-footed ride with solid traction.

Family-Friendly Scooter

The Ather Rizta’s 2.9 kWh battery with around 123 km claimed range and 80 km/h top speed gives a calm but capable feel. The seat feels relatively roomy and comfy for pillion too. For daily errands or school runs, it feels practical. Suspension and handling stay predictable in town traffic. Charging overnight fits easily into my schedule.

Good Balance For Everyday Use

I bought the Ather Rizta for its mix of features and performance. With options going from 123 km/chg declared range and a top speed around 75-76 km/h, it suits both daily chores and an occasional longer ride. The under-seat space and frunk practicality, and the 7-inch digital cluster is user-friendly. Ride quality is good, but I noticed in heavy rain the footboard splashback is a little more than expected.
